Fazendo alterações modprobe permanentes

2

Eu tenho um módulo que não funciona a menos que eu primeiro descarregue um módulo diferente:

modprobe -r bdc_pci
modprobe facetimehd

A execução desses comandos (sudo) funciona bem e minha webcam funciona conforme o esperado. Mas agora quero tornar essa mudança permanente.

As outras postagens que eu vi sobre como fazer alterações no modprobe permanentemente giram em torno de tornar um módulo novo permanente, mas o que eu não tenho certeza sobre como fazer isso enquanto assegurava o módulo bdc_pci é descarregado primeiro. Como eu faço isso?

    
por Tom Dalton 26.02.2016 / 10:54

2 respostas

2

É melhor criar um arquivo conf separado para colocar um módulo na lista negra. Desta forma, será mais fácil encontrar ou reverter esta configuração.

Executar no terminal

sudo tee /etc/modprobe.d/blacklist-bdc_pci.conf <<< "blacklist bdc_pci"

Isso impedirá que bdc_pci module seja carregado na inicialização.

Para carregar automaticamente facetimehd , execute:

sudo tee -a /etc/modules <<< "facetimehd"
    
por Pilot6 26.02.2016 / 11:20
3

Se você não quiser carregar bdc_pci module, adicione-o à lista negra em:% /etc/modprobe.d/blacklist.conf no final deste arquivo como este:

blacklist bdc_pci    

(ou você pode criar seu próprio arquivo, por exemplo. blacklist-bdc_pci.conf )

Em seguida, em /etc/modules você pode adicionar o módulo que deseja carregar, então você precisa editar este arquivo e adicionar:

facetimehd
    
por EdiD 26.02.2016 / 11:01